The World Health Organization convened an emergency meeting Thursday to discuss whether to declare the spiraling outbreak of monkeypox as a global health emergency.
This would give the virus the same distinction as the COVID-19 pandemic and ongoing global efforts to eradicate polio.
The international health body does not expect to announce any decision before Friday local time.
To date, the U.S. Centers for Disease Control and Prevention has confirmed over 33-hundred cases of monkeypox in 42 countries where the virus isn't typically found.
80 percent of those cases were in Europe.
